You probably recognize the Wendy’s logo – a smiling red-haired girl with freckles and blue bows in her pigtails. But did you know there’s a hidden detail in that iconic design? Wendy’s was named after the daughter of founder Dave Thomas, and he chose to include another family member in the logo. If you take a close look at Wendy’s ruffled collar, you’ll spot the word “MOM.”
